Transaction 57703564c2055dd6153fa722b4f62677c2e36adb4c148bb4fb53424ef776a970
1 Input
1 Output
-
57703564c2055dd6153fa722b4f62677c2e36adb4c148bb4fb53424ef776a970:0
- value
- 252709
- script pubkey
- OP_0 OP_PUSHBYTES_20 73ec91d360f55cce10b33b06cb34b40b0f44e1aa
- address
- bc1qw0kfr5mq74wvuy9n8vrvkd95pv85fcd23jytcz